Utility Fortum’s EU ETS emissions up 4.2% amid lower hydro

Published 12:41 on February 1, 2019  /  Last updated at 12:41 on February 1, 2019  / Ben Garside /  EMEA, EU ETS

Finnish utility Fortum emitted 2.5 million tonnes of CO2 from its EU ETS-regulated facilities over 2018, up 4.2% year-on-year, it said in financial results on Friday.
